Creativity

from class:

Educational Psychology

Definition

Creativity is the ability to produce new and original ideas, solutions, or artistic expressions by combining existing concepts in novel ways. It encompasses critical thinking, problem-solving, and innovative approaches that allow individuals to think outside the box. This term plays a significant role in assessing student performance and in fostering the unique talents of gifted individuals.

5 Must Know Facts For Your Next Test

  1. Creativity can be assessed through performance tasks that allow individuals to demonstrate their ability to generate innovative ideas or solutions.
  2. Authentic assessments that require real-world problem-solving can provide a more accurate measure of a student's creative abilities compared to traditional testing methods.
  3. Gifted and talented education programs often emphasize the development of creativity as a key component of nurturing exceptional students.
  4. Creative individuals are more likely to excel in collaborative environments where they can share and refine ideas with others.
  5. Fostering creativity in educational settings can lead to enhanced engagement and motivation among students, allowing them to reach their full potential.

Review Questions

  • How does creativity impact performance assessment and the evaluation of student learning?
    • Creativity significantly impacts performance assessment because it allows educators to evaluate how well students can apply their knowledge in practical situations. Authentic assessments that incorporate creative tasks help gauge a student's ability to think critically and solve problems innovatively. This approach shifts focus from rote memorization to understanding concepts deeply and applying them creatively, which is essential for true learning.
  • What role does creativity play in the education of gifted and talented students?
    • In the education of gifted and talented students, creativity is vital as it helps nurture their unique abilities and allows them to express their potential fully. Educational programs for these students often include activities designed to enhance creative thinking skills, encouraging them to explore diverse perspectives and generate innovative solutions. By emphasizing creativity, educators can foster an environment where gifted learners feel challenged and engaged.
  • Evaluate the significance of fostering creativity within the classroom environment for all students.
    • Fostering creativity in the classroom is significant because it cultivates a culture of innovation and critical thinking among all students, not just the gifted ones. When teachers encourage creative expression, students are more likely to develop problem-solving skills and collaborate effectively with their peers. This inclusive approach not only enhances academic performance but also prepares students for future challenges in a rapidly changing world where creativity is increasingly valued across various fields.
